Having issues getting RetroArch working with advanced launcher. Im using the latest Kodi build of OpenElec BETA2 from Nov12. I have retroarch installed to /storage/.kodi/addons/emulator.retroarch.
Heres the steps i do....
1. Add New Launcher
2. Select, Files launcher (e.g game emulator)
3. Navigate to, /storage/.kodi/addons/emulator.retroarch/bin/retroarch.sh and select as launcher application
3. Select my file path for the roms, (kodi/addons/emulator.retroarch/roms/nes)
4. Set the files extensions as, nes|zip
5. Set Application arguments as, fceumm "%rom%"
6. named title of launcher as, NES
7. Set platform as, Nintendo Entertainment System
8. Skipped thumbnail locations for the moment
9. Selected 'nintendo' and selected 'Add Items'
10. Manually added 1 nes game
11. Selected 'nintendo' and game shown in the list
12. Select game but nothing happens
Have i done anything wrong in the above steps as im not sure why this Advanced Launcher isnt working with RetroArch?
